Brook, what kind of bag do you use for your camera? When I take my point and shoot I just slip it in my regualr bag I use for vacation. Just a canvess type purse thing. Really ugly but holds what I need. When I take my SLR I take a camera bag, and try to put as much as I can in the side pocket. It's so bulky though and the bag isn't that great, so I can't bring much of the extras that I like to bring. It's not padded well, so I may need to get another one. Since I got a new camera that is a tad bigger than my Rebel, the other bag I have that is smaller , but more padded won't work. I can't fit the camera in with a lens and no side pockets in it either.I think I have to bite the bullet and buy a different one for my needs and just give up taking a purse, and try to fit what I can in our take along bag with Claire extra stuff in it. I have decided that my point and shoot just doesn't get the shots I want. It's terrible in restaurants, and if I do use the flash, it takes forever in a day to recharge. It also seems to have problems lately. It would click a picture, but the creeen goes black. No picture was taken and you have to restart it to get it to work again. Ah Decisions to make!

We have the Lowepro SlingShot 100 AW.

18-2034-IMG1.jpeg

It's large enough for the SLR and a few accessories. You could easily fit a lens in there, plus the top part is another compartment. We use it for our video camera, but it could easily hold extra lenses. On the strap there is a spot for a media card, and I think it even has a spot for a tripod, so you can do a "quick release" type thing. We only bring our mini-tripod into the parks. It can fit in my pocket if necessary! :goodvibes

Joe wears this on his back, while I wear the Baggalini. It works really well for us. The camera does fit into the Baggalini too without a problem, BUT, we wanted something that keeps it safer. They sell this bag in a few sizes-this is the smallest. I would definitely recommend it!

Ya know, now that I have my Rebel XS, I'm not sure exactly what settings to use! Do you use the program settings, or do you use Tv, Av, A-Dep???? I will play around with the settings, but I think I need to know exactly what to use so I don't blow the important shots next month! Your pics are so great, I would really like to do as well as you. Thanks for any and all help!

Thank you! We mostly just use the "point and shoot" type setting, without flash if we can. It's all the camera taking those good shots!! :laughing: Occasionally we will play with the settings-like for fireworks or Spectro. For those we use Av (aperture priority), giving it the largest possible aperture (so smallest number) and the ISO up as high it will go, 1600. This will allow the light in, but also stop the action some so your pictures won't be blurry. We like the results with these settings - I learned about them over on the Photography Board. :thumbsup2 All the CP pictures from this last update were done in "point and shoot" without flash. (the green box on the dial). We probably could get slightly better pictures if we played with the settings more, but its just easier to do the point and shoot and live in the moment than deal with the settings - someday maybe we'll be fast enough to do both!
